“The power of a small elite which possessed most of the wealth was greater than the power of the republican government elected by the people, presumably to run the country in the interests of all its citizens. This group was determined to preserve its privileged position and thus its money. …….. there had been a virtual alliance between the possessor class and the Republic, which it manipulated through its control of the press, the financing of political parties, and the handling of its vast funds to influence the fiscal policies of government. …….The Bankers and the Businessmen had learned the technique of how, in a democratic society, to thwart the will of the majority”
-William L. Shirer, writing about the troubles in France during the 1930’s, in his book: “The Collapse of the Third Republic”
